Статьи

Как добавить запись в fstab

В мире Linux, где гибкость и настройка системы являются ключевыми, файл fstab играет важнейшую роль. Он представляет собой своеобразный «путеводитель» для вашей операционной системы, определяя, как различные файловые системы и устройства хранения данных будут интегрированы в общую структуру. 🤝 Представьте себе, что это карта, на которой обозначены все ваши жесткие диски, флешки, сетевые ресурсы и другие хранилища. Каждое хранилище имеет свое местоположение, тип доступа и способ взаимодействия с системой. Именно fstab содержит все эти сведения, позволяя Linux автоматически монтировать нужные разделы при загрузке.

Что такое fstab и зачем он нужен

Fstab — это текстовый файл конфигурации, который расположен в каталоге /etc/fstab. 📜 Его название — сокращение от "file systems table" (таблица файловых систем). Он содержит информацию о всех файловых системах, которые используются в вашей системе Linux, будь то локальные жесткие диски, сетевые ресурсы или внешние устройства хранения данных. 💾

Зачем нужен этот файл?

  • Автоматическое монтирование: Самая важная функция fstab — это автоматическое монтирование файловых систем при загрузке системы. Вам не нужно каждый раз вручную подключать нужные разделы после запуска Linux. Система сама «знает», что и куда нужно подключать. 🪄
  • Определение точки монтирования: fstab указывает, в какой каталог будет смонтирован раздел. Например, вы можете указать, что раздел /dev/sda1 должен быть смонтирован в каталог /mnt/data.
  • Определение параметров монтирования: Вы можете задать различные параметры для каждого раздела, например, права доступа, тип файловой системы, опции монтирования (например, nofail, ro, rw).
  • Управление файловыми системами: fstab позволяет вам определять, как система будет взаимодействовать с различными файловыми системами.

Пример записи в fstab

Давайте рассмотрим пример записи в fstab:

/dev/sda1 /mnt/data ext4 defaults 0 2

Разберем эту запись:
  • /dev/sda1 — это имя устройства (раздела жесткого диска).
  • /mnt/data — это точка монтирования, каталог, в который будет смонтирован раздел.
  • ext4 — это тип файловой системы.
  • defaults — это набор стандартных параметров монтирования.
  • 0 2 — это параметры резервного копирования и проверки файловой системы.

Где находится файл fstab

Файл fstab расположен в каталоге /etc. 📍 Это стандартное местоположение для конфигурационных файлов в системах Linux. Вы можете открыть и отредактировать его с помощью любого текстового редактора, например, nano, vim или gedit. Будьте очень внимательны при редактировании этого файла! Ошибки в fstab могут привести к проблемам с загрузкой системы. ⚠️

Как добавить запись в fstab

Добавление записи в fstab — это несложная процедура, которая требует внимательности и аккуратности.

Шаг 1: Определение устройства и точки монтирования.
  • Сначала определите имя устройства, которое вы хотите добавить в fstab. Это может быть раздел жесткого диска, флешка, сетевой ресурс и т.д.
  • Вы можете использовать команду lsblk для просмотра всех устройств хранения данных.
  • Затем выберите каталог, в который хотите смонтировать устройство. Это будет точка монтирования.
Шаг 2: Открытие файла fstab.
  • Откройте файл fstab с помощью текстового редактора. Например, введите в терминале:

bash

sudo nano /etc/fstab

  • Обратите внимание, что для редактирования fstab вам потребуются права администратора (sudo).
Шаг 3: Добавление записи.
  • В конце файла добавьте новую строку с информацией о вашем устройстве. Строка должна содержать следующие элементы:

<устройство> <точка_монтирования> <тип_файловой_системы> <параметры_монтирования> <пасворд> <проверка>

  • Например, если вы хотите смонтировать раздел /dev/sdb1 в каталог /mnt/data с использованием файловой системы ext4 и стандартными параметрами монтирования, то запись будет выглядеть так:

/dev/sdb1 /mnt/data ext4 defaults 0 2

Шаг 4: Сохранение изменений.
  • Сохраните изменения в файле fstab. В nano это делается комбинацией клавиш Ctrl+X, затем Y и Enter.
Шаг 5: Проверка монтирования.
  • Перезагрузите систему. После перезагрузки Linux автоматически смонтирует раздел в соответствии с вашими настройками в fstab.
  • Вы можете проверить, что раздел успешно смонтирован, с помощью команды:

bash

df -h

Как сделать автоматическое монтирование диска в Linux

Автоматическое монтирование — это удобная функция, которая позволяет Linux автоматически подключать нужные разделы при загрузке. Вместо того, чтобы каждый раз вручную монтировать нужные устройства, вы можете просто добавить их в fstab.

Пример:

Допустим, вы подключили новый жесткий диск и хотите, чтобы он автоматически монтировался в каталог /mnt/new_disk при загрузке системы.

  1. Определите имя устройства нового диска. Вы можете использовать команду lsblk.
  2. Создайте каталог /mnt/new_disk.
  3. Добавьте следующую строку в файл /etc/fstab:

/dev/sdb1 /mnt/new_disk ext4 defaults 0 2

  1. Сохраните изменения и перезагрузите систему.

Как смонтировать диск в Astra Linux

Astra Linux — это российская операционная система на основе Debian. Процесс монтирования диска в Astra Linux аналогичен процессу монтирования в других дистрибутивах Linux.

Шаги:
  1. Запустите Astra Linux.
  2. Создайте папку для точки монтирования. Например, в домашней папке /home/user/ создайте папку archive.
  3. Определите логические имена дисков. Используйте команду lsblk для просмотра всех устройств хранения данных.
  4. Выберите диск, который хотите смонтировать. Исключите системный диск /dev/sda.
  5. Откройте выбранный диск. Например, /dev/sdb.
  6. Выберите тип таблицы разделов. Для новых дисков рекомендуется использовать GPT.
  7. Создайте раздел на диске.
  8. Отформатируйте раздел. Выберите нужную файловую систему (например, ext4).
  9. Добавьте запись в fstab. Используйте шаги, описанные выше.
  10. Перезагрузите систему.

Советы и рекомендации по работе с fstab

  • Будьте осторожны при редактировании fstab. Ошибки в этом файле могут привести к проблемам с загрузкой системы.
  • Создавайте резервную копию fstab перед внесением изменений. Это позволит вам восстановить файл в случае возникновения ошибок.
  • Используйте комментарии в fstab. Это поможет вам и другим пользователям понять, что делает каждая запись.
  • Проверяйте монтирование после внесения изменений. Убедитесь, что раздел смонтирован в нужное место и с нужными параметрами.
  • Изучите параметры монтирования. Существует множество параметров монтирования, которые вы можете использовать для настройки файловых систем.
  • Не используйте пробелы в именах устройств и точках монтирования.

Выводы

Файл fstab — это важный элемент системы Linux, который позволяет вам управлять файловыми системами и устройствами хранения данных. Он обеспечивает автоматическое монтирование разделов при загрузке системы, упрощая работу с различными хранилищами данных.

Важно помнить, что fstab — это мощный инструмент, и нужно быть осторожным при его использовании. Внимательно изучите документацию и рекомендации перед внесением изменений в этот файл.

Часто задаваемые вопросы (FAQ)

  • Что делать, если я случайно испортил fstab?

В таком случае вам может потребоваться запустить систему в режиме восстановления и отредактировать fstab вручную.

  • Можно ли монтировать сетевые ресурсы через fstab?

Да, вы можете монтировать сетевые ресурсы, такие как NFS или SMB, через fstab.

  • Как отключить автоматическое монтирование раздела?

Для этого просто удалите соответствующую строку из файла fstab.

  • Что такое опции монтирования?

Опции монтирования — это параметры, которые определяют, как файловая система будет монтироваться. Например, ro — монтирование только для чтения, rw — монтирование для чтения и записи.

  • Как узнать тип файловой системы раздела?

Вы можете использовать команду blkid для определения типа файловой системы раздела.

  • Как отмонтировать раздел?

Для отмонтирования раздела используйте команду umount.

  • Что делать, если раздел не монтируется?

Проверьте права доступа, параметры монтирования и убедитесь, что устройство корректно определено в системе.

Надеюсь, эта статья была вам полезна! 🍀 Желаю успехов в освоении Linux! 🐧

Как слить воду с посудомойки DEXP
Вверх
...